Where we are, relative to Gravesend
Omega Physical Therapy has one office, at 2327 83rd Street, Suite C, Brooklyn, NY 11214, and we see patients from Gravesend there.
Where Bensonhurst ends and Gravesend begins depends on which map you are reading. Some draw the line at Bay Parkway, others at Stillwell Avenue further east. The practice sits in the 11214 ZIP code and describes itself as being in Bensonhurst — but it is close enough to the boundary that mapping services routinely file the block under Gravesend. The practical version: if you live in Gravesend, this is closer than the distance on a map suggests.

Getting here from Gravesend
Gravesend has more subway options than anywhere else we serve — the N and W on the Sea Beach Line at Kings Highway, Avenue U and 86th Street; the D on the West End Line at 25th Avenue and Bay 50th Street; and the F on the Culver Line at Kings Highway, Avenue U and Avenue X. The one that matters here is the D at 25th Avenue: it is about a third of a mile from the office, and it is a Gravesend station, so for a good part of the neighborhood this is a local trip on a line you already use.
The B1 runs west along 86th Street from the Ocean Parkway end of Gravesend and stops within three blocks of the office. The B82 and B82 SBS cover Kings Highway, and the B6 comes down Bay Parkway. Driving, 86th Street and Bay Parkway are the two direct routes, and the Belt Parkway runs along the neighborhood’s southern edge if you are coming from the shore side.
What treatment looks like here
Every appointment is one-on-one with Dr. Dmitry Shestakovsky, DPT, who evaluates you himself and builds an individual plan rather than working from a standard protocol. The practice’s stated approach is to treat the cause of the problem rather than the symptoms, which is why the first visit is spent on assessment.
